The non-dairy ice cream market in Australia is experiencing strong growth due to the rise in lactose intolerance and vegan lifestyles. Leading brands are expanding their product ranges to include coconut, almond, and oat-based options. Health-focused and indulgent flavors are driving consumer interest.
The non-dairy ice cream market in Australia is growing due to increasing demand for plant-based and allergen-free desserts. Rising popularity of coconut, soy, and almond-based ice creams, increasing product innovation in flavor and texture, and growing availability in supermarkets and specialty stores are driving market growth. Increasing awareness about health and wellness and rising focus on sustainable and natural ingredients are also supporting market expansion.
The non-dairy ice cream market in Australia is constrained by high production costs due to the need for plant-based ingredients and specialized processing. Regulatory requirements for food safety and product labeling increase operational complexity. Competition from traditional dairy ice cream and other non-dairy frozen desserts reduces market demand. Limited consumer acceptance and taste consistency challenges further restrict market growth.

Non-dairy ice cream products are regulated by FSANZ for ingredient safety, nutritional labeling, and allergen warnings. The ACCC monitors advertising claims and ensures compliance with food safety laws. Import and export of non-dairy ice cream are governed under trade agreements and food safety standards. Financial support is available for product innovation under the Modern Manufacturing Initiative.
